    There are quite a few. Cannot think about any post-apocalyptic ones, but here are my favorites:
    Fury MAX: My War Gone By
    The Filth
    Flex Mentallo (Technically superhero-esque, but not really. It's really a metaphore and the combined history of the comic book industry AND Grant Morrison, disguised as a superhero story.)
    Preacher
    The Invisibles
    Zero
    Black Science

    East of West by Hickman is fantastic. It's more alternate history than post-apocalyptic, but the story is very well done.
    I don't think you can get more post-apocalyptic than The Walking Dead. Even if you're not a fan of the show, the graphic novel is really good. It's very dark.

    Afaic, Hellboy just gets better and better through its run. It starts off good and goes from there...(I agree with the suggestion above about going for the Library Editions instead of the trades. The LE's are good value and frankly they are such nice books to own!)

    BPRD is really great too.

    Fear Agent is fantastic all out action sci-fi zaniness.

    The Sixth Gun...great

    I'm not sure about Lovecraft porn, but Lovecraft noir is great in Fatale

    I'd also recommend Afterlife With Archie

    Oh yes, and The Goon!

    ...as far as Post Apoc goes, I haven't read it but Wasteland gets lots of praise...
